Mission: What is Hearst Mission Statement?
Hearst's mission is 'to inform, entertain, and inspire, continuing a legacy of innovation and a love of what's next.'
Hearst's mission statement highlights its commitment to a broad audience, delivering content and services that inform, entertain, and inspire. This includes consumers of news and entertainment, alongside businesses seeking critical data and solutions. The company's global reach extends across 30 countries, employing approximately 22,000 individuals as of 2024, reflecting its diverse operations.

Vision: What is Hearst Vision Statement?
Hearst's vision is 'to be alarmingly enterprising and startlingly original by looking forward and leading our industries to new frontiers.'
The Hearst vision statement emphasizes pioneering new frontiers and leading industries, reflecting a commitment to disruption and market leadership. This future-oriented outlook, rooted in the ambitious spirit of its founder, implicitly covers all its diversified segments, from traditional media to B2B information services. The company's strategic acquisitions and investments align with this aspirational yet realistic vision.

Hearst's vision for the future is deeply rooted in its founder's charge to be alarmingly enterprising and startlingly original. This commitment to looking forward and leading industries to new frontiers is evident in its strategic decisions. For example, in 2024, Hearst achieved a record revenue of $13 billion, marking a 9% increase, largely due to its successful diversification into business information services. The company's ongoing strategy to strengthen legacy brands while embracing digital futures and niche content areas is highlighted by recent acquisitions, such as MotorTrend Group in December 2024 and the Austin American-Statesman in March 2025. This aggressive yet measured expansion, coupled with investments in generative AI and B2B solutions, aligns with the Hearst mission vision values. Values: What is Hearst Core Values Statement?
Hearst Communications operates with a strong foundation built upon core values that guide its strategic decisions and daily operations. These principles, including purpose, integrity, and a culture of care, define the company's approach to media, business, and community engagement.
Hearst is driven by a profound sense of purpose to inform audiences and improve lives. This commitment is evident in its high-quality, trusted content across media properties, such as the investigative journalism of the San Francisco Chronicle and Houston Chronicle, and in Hearst Health's solutions aimed at improving patient outcomes.
Ethics and excellence are hallmarks of Hearst's operations, ensuring that customers, business partners, and audiences can rely on the accuracy and fairness of its products and services. This value fosters a workplace where employees are treated with respect and decisions are based on equal opportunity, promoting transparent dealings in all aspects of its business, including financial services like Fitch Group.
Hearst is deeply invested in its people and the communities it serves, emphasizing employee well-being through a healthy work environment, supportive programs, and benefits. This is exemplified by initiatives like the Neurodiversity@Hearst internship program, which invests in neurodiverse talent, and the company's long-standing history of philanthropic giving to nonprofit organizations.
Across every division, Hearst colleagues are connected by a shared value of innovation, driving product development such as Hearst Newspapers using AI to better target subscription offers. This commitment is also evident in the development of AURA, an enhanced data platform for advertisers by Hearst Magazines, and Hearst Ventures' investments in emerging technologies and healthcare companies.
These Hearst core values and leadership principles collectively define the company's identity and strategic direction. How Mission & Vision Influence Hearst Business?
A company's mission and vision statements are fundamental to its strategic direction, guiding decisions from daily operations to long-term growth initiatives. These statements articulate the company's purpose and aspirations, influencing how it adapts to market changes and pursues innovation.
Hearst's mission and vision are deeply integrated into its strategic decision-making, driving its diversification and growth across various sectors.
- The mission to 'inform audiences and improve lives' shapes its content and service offerings.
- The vision to be 'alarmingly enterprising and startlingly original' fuels its pursuit of innovation and new ventures.
- These statements directly influence strategic pivots, such as the expansion into business-to-business (B2B) information services.
- The company's commitment to quality and integrity underpins its operational standards and long-term planning.
Hearst's strategic focus on B2B information services is a direct manifestation of its mission to improve lives through essential data and analysis.
By 2024, B2B businesses represented over 50% of Hearst's total profits, a significant increase from approximately 15% a decade prior, demonstrating the success of this strategic direction.
Acquisitions like QGenda in August 2024 for Hearst Health exemplify the mission to enhance patient care through improved workforce management, aligning with the broader goal of improving lives.
Investments in digital transformation, including the launch of ESPN's streaming service and the application of generative AI, reflect the vision's emphasis on being 'startlingly original' and embracing future technologies.
The company achieved a record revenue of $13 billion in 2024, underscoring the effectiveness of its mission and vision in driving financial success amidst evolving market conditions.
A commitment to 'quality and integrity' ensures that Hearst's journalistic endeavors maintain high standards of accuracy and fairness, even when facing market pressures.
Hearst's strong financial position, including no net debt, enables continued growth through acquisitions and internal investment, allowing it to navigate challenges and fulfill commitments to its employees and communities.

What Are Mission & Vision Improvements?
Enhancing Hearst's mission and vision statements can better reflect its current diversified operations and future strategic direction. Explicitly acknowledging its role as a global information and services provider, particularly given that B2B now accounts for over 50% of profits, would provide a more accurate representation of its business model.
Refining the mission to explicitly include its role as a global information and services provider would better capture its significant B2B portfolio, which now drives over 50% of profits.
The vision could be made more concrete by explicitly mentioning sustainability and digital leadership, aligning with current market expectations and the company's forward-looking investments.
To address the impact of emerging technologies like generative AI on digital traffic, the company might need to further emphasize its role as a developer and ethical deployer, not just a user.
The shift to digital video and streaming, where digital video spend overtook linear video in 2024, necessitates continuous adaptation in content delivery and monetization models, as seen in investments like ESPN's streaming service.
